What a Copyeditor Does
- Makes a manuscript shine, retaining its author’s voice and style.
- Checks spelling, grammar, accuracy, completeness, and consistency of expression.
- Uses style guides to note editing decisions making sure they are applied throughout the project.
What Is Neologistics?
Neologistics is a portmanteu, a new word formed from the elision of two derivative words:
| neologism | a new word, usage, or expression | |
| logistics | the handling of the details of an operation |
It characterizes the overall process of preparing materials for publication.
